Crawlspace waterproofing services typically involve the installation of systems designed to prevent moisture intrusion and manage water that may accumulate beneath a building. These systems often include the placement of vapor barriers, drainage mats, and sump pumps to direct water away from the foundation. The goal is to create a dry environment beneath the property, which can help reduce the risk of water infiltration that might lead to structural issues or mold growth. Proper waterproofing can also involve sealing cracks and gaps in the foundation walls to further prevent water entry.
Addressing moisture problems in crawlspaces through waterproofing can help solve issues such as mold development, wood rot, and musty odors that often originate from damp environments. Excess moisture in these areas can also attract pests and contribute to the deterioration of building materials over time. By controlling water intrusion and maintaining a dry crawlspace, property owners can protect the integrity of their foundation and improve indoor air quality. Waterproofing services are designed to mitigate these concerns before they develop into more significant and costly problems.

The overview below groups typical Crawlspace Waterproofing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Washington, MI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Cost Range - The typical cost for crawlspace waterproofing services varies between $1,500 and $5,000. Factors such as the size of the area and the extent of waterproofing needed influence the final price, with example projects costing around $2,500 on average.
Installation Expenses - Installing sump pumps, vapor barriers, and drainage systems can add to the overall cost, often ranging from $1,200 to $4,000. Larger or more complex crawlspaces may incur higher expenses depending on the scope of work.
Material Costs - The choice of waterproofing materials impacts costs, with basic sealants starting around $300 and more comprehensive systems reaching up to $2,000.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ific material selections and crawlspace conditions.
Additional Fees - Additional costs may include prep work, repairs, or addressing existing issues, typically adding $500 to $1,500 to the project. Contact local service providers for detailed quotes tailored to individual crawlspace need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is crawlspace waterproofing? Crawlspace waterproofing involves measures taken to prevent water intrusion and moisture buildup in the crawlspace area to protect the home’s foundation and indoor air quality.
Why should I consider crawlspace waterproofing? Waterproofing can help prevent mold growth, reduce humidity levels, and protect the foundation from water damage, contributing to a healthier home environment.
What methods are used for crawlspace waterproofing? Local service providers may use techniques such as installing vapor barriers, exterior drainage systems, sump pumps, and sealing cracks to keep the crawlspace dry.
How long does crawlspace waterproofing typically last? The durability of waterproofing solutions varies depending on the methods used and local conditions, but professional installations generally provide long-term protection.
